Job Title: Primary Teacher

Job Type: 8 am – 4pm

Location: Croydon

Salary: £140- £210 Per day

The Role: Primary Teacher – Croydon

As a Primary Teacher, you’ll be teaching a Year 3 Class playing a vital role in shaping the learning journey of pupils as they transition into Key Stage 2. You will be responsible for planning and delivering engaging, creative, and inclusive lessons that inspire curiosity, deepen understanding, and promote a lifelong love of learning.

You will create a nurturing and stimulating classroom environment where every child feels safe, valued, and motivated to achieve their full potential. Through strong classroom management, high expectations, and thoughtful differentiation, you will support all learners to make excellent progress — academically, socially, and emotionally.

A Primary Teacher you will be expected to:

  • Plan and deliver engaging, well-structured lessons in line with the National Curriculum, tailored to meet the needs of all learners.
  • Create a positive and inclusive classroom environment that promotes high expectations for behaviour, achievement, and personal development.
  • Assess, monitor, and report on pupil progress regularly, using data to inform planning and next steps.
  • Differentiate teaching and learning activities to support pupils of varying abilities, including those with SEND and EAL needs.
  • Work collaboratively with colleagues, including teaching assistants, phase leaders, and subject coordinators, to share best practice and ensure a consistent approach across the school.
  • Establish and maintain strong communication with parents and carers, offering regular updates on progress and involving them in the learning journey.
  • Contributing to curriculum planning, resource development, and whole-school improvement.
  • Maintain accurate records of pupil progress, behaviour, and attendance, in line with school policies and procedures.

Qualifications and requirements – Primary Teacher – Croydon

  • QTS is required
  • Enhanced DBS is required
  • Proven ability to solve problems quickly and remain calm
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
